Details
Each vessel has lobed sides rising to a wide everted rim, resting on a short foot ring. The lobed cover is pierced with an aperture in the centre. The stone is of a pale whitish-green tone with sporadic areas of apple-green.
4¼ in. (10.8 cm.) diam., box


Provenance
H.R.H. The Princess Mary, Princess Royal, Countess of Harewood (1897-1965) at Chesterfield House, London, and subsequently by descent at Harewood House, Yorkshire
Harewood: Collecting in The Royal Tradition, sold at Christie's London, 5 December 2012, lot 619
